CVE-2026-58494 — Wasmtime: WASI hard links bypass wasmtime-wasi's FilePerms for destination
Wasmtime is a runtime for WebAssembly. Prior to 24.0.11, 36.0.12, 45.0.3, and 46.0.1, wasmtime-wasi hard-link creation and renaming check directory permissions but not matching FilePerms on source and destination preopens, allowing a WASI guest with a read-only source file capability to overwrite host files exposed as FilePerms::READ through wasip1, wasip2, or wasip3 filesystem interfaces. This issue is fixed in versions 24.0.11, 36.0.12, 45.0.3, and 46.0.1.
